Western-Inspired Fashion

Western-inspired fashion has a rich history, dating back to the 19th century when cowboys and ranchers wore practical clothing to protect themselves from the elements. Over time, Western fashion evolved, incorporating elements from Native American and Mexican cultures. The 1970s and 1980s saw a resurgence of Western-inspired fashion, with designers like Ralph Lauren and Calvin Klein incorporating elements like denim, leather, and suede into their collections.

What jacket does Rip wear in Yellowstone?

Rip Wheeler, the rugged and charismatic ranch hand played by Cole Hauser in the popular TV series Yellowstone, is often seen wearing a Carhartt jacket. Specifically, it’s the Carhartt Quilted Flannel Lined Active Jac, which has become an iconic part of his character’s image. The jacket’s durability, comfort, and practicality make it an excellent choice for Rip’s outdoor lifestyle.

Why does Rip wear a Carhartt jacket in Yellowstone?

Rip’s choice of jacket is not just a random fashion statement. Carhartt is a well-known brand in the ranching and outdoor communities, and their jackets are renowned for their quality, durability, and functionality. The show’s creators likely chose Carhartt to add an air of authenticity to Rip’s character, as well as to reflect the rugged, no-nonsense attitude of the ranching lifestyle.
